C# pass by reference out
WebFollowing is a simple example of passing parameters by reference in the c# programming language. int x = 10; // Variable need to be initialized. Multiplication (ref x); If you observe … WebMar 8, 2024 · #22 Passing by Reference - C# Tutorials for Beginners CoffeeNCode. ... 06 : 43. C# Out parameters Vs REF parameters.NET Interview Preparation videos. 225 16 : 54. Learn C# for beginners: 42 - Pass by Reference vs Pass by Value. Jesse Dietrichson. 18 15 : 29. C#.Net Tutorial 11 - Passing by Reference and Passing Functions as …
C# pass by reference out
Did you know?
WebConclusion. ‘out’ parameter in C# allows users to pass arguments by reference to a method. Variable used as ‘out’ parameter does not require to be initialized before it is passed to a method. The called method should assign value to the out parameter before it returns a value. WebDec 5, 2024 · In call by reference, the called method changes the value of the parameters passed to it from the calling method. Any changes made to the parameters in the called method will be reflected in the parameters …
Web導致出現預期的錯誤,即“屬性或索引器可能無法作為out或ref參數傳遞” 最后,我打算做的是-遍歷對象列表,為每個對象生成一個按鈕,並為該按鈕添加onclick事件,這將打開一個新表單,並傳遞該對象的引用,以便其內容可以以該新形式進行編輯。 WebSep 11, 2024 · Hence, pass by reference must be used very carefully. 3. Pass by Output. The out keyword indicates a value that is passed by reference type. It is pretty similar to …
WebExperienced Senior Software Engineer with a demonstrated history of working in the Energy Trading Risk Management (ETRM). Skilled in Allegro 8.0, C#, MS SQL, SSIS, SSRS. Strong Engineering Professional with Master of Computer Applications focused in Computer Science and Engineering, from Visvesvaraya Technological University Bangalore (2014 … WebAug 10, 2024 · Ref and out keywords in C# are used to pass arguments within a method or function. Both indicate that an argument/parameter is passed by reference. By default …
WebMar 18, 2024 · The following is an example of passing a value type parameter to a method by value: Create a console application with the following steps. File -->new -->Project. Select the Console Application …
WebMost of the primitive data types such as integer, double, Boolean etc. are passed by value. Reference Parameters. Reference Parameters copies the reference to the memory location of an argument into the formal parameter. Normally, all the objects are passed by reference as parameter to the method. The method operates on the references of the ... boreal consultingThe out keyword causes arguments to be passed by reference. It makes the formal parameter an alias for the argument, which must be a variable. In other words, any operation on the parameter is made on the argument. It is like the ref keyword, except that ref requires that the variable be initialized before it is … See more Declaring a method with out arguments is a classic workaround to return multiple values. Consider value tuples for similar scenarios. The following example uses outto return three variables with a single method call. The … See more You can declare a variable in a separate statement before you pass it as an out argument. The following example declares a variable named … See more For more information, see the C# Language Specification. The language specification is the definitive source for C# syntax and usage. See more boreal conservationWebOct 13, 2024 · Using the out modifier, we initialize a variable inside the method. Like ref, anything that happens in the method alters the variable outside the method. With ref, you have the choice to not make changes … boreal construction rocklandWebSep 15, 2024 · In this article. You can use the out keyword in two contexts:. As a parameter modifier, which lets you pass an argument to a method by reference rather than by value.. In generic type parameter declarations for interfaces and delegates, which specifies that a type parameter is covariant.. See also. C# Reference boreal coniferous forestWebApr 11, 2024 · The C# language from the very first version supported passing arguments by value or by reference. But before C# 7 the C# compiler supported only one way of returning a value from a method (or a property) – returning by value. This has been changed in C# 7 with two new features: ref returns and ref locals. havaheartrescue.org/adoptWebC# : Can I pass primitive types by reference in C#?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As I promised, I have a se... havaheart rescue springfield moWebFeb 8, 2024 · The ref keyword indicates that a variable is a reference, or an alias for another object. It's used in five different contexts: In a method signature and in a method call, to … boreal construction